Notice; request for comments, and notice of public meeting; change of location.
The location of the upcoming public meeting being held in New Orleans, Louisiana, is changed. Instead of the Hale Boggs Federal Building, as previously announced in the Federal Register, the meeting will take place at the Hyatt Regency New Orleans. The date of the meeting, February 10, and the hours, from 9 a.m. to 12 p.m. remain the same. In the recently enacted Coast Guard and Maritime Transportation Act of 2004, the Congress directed the Coast Guard to add towing vessels to the list of vessels subject to inspections, and to consider the establishment of a safety management system appropriate for towing vessels. Through public meetings, we are seeking public and industry involvement as we consider how to proceed.
Comments and related material must reach the Docket Management Facility on or before March 23, 2005. A public meeting will be held on February 10, 2005, in New Orleans, LA. Meetings in Oakland, CA, and St. Louis, MO, remain unchanged as previously announced in the Federal Register [69 FR 78471].
